Output ec3cbae289bc02ff7e1fd16b9c6abbbaef403855ea250181a83acb183f71a5cf:0

value
6958776885087
script pubkey
OP_0 OP_PUSHBYTES_20 3044d66c0e0dc9796bdd0c219348656f2a0c2b6d
address
tb1qxpzdvmqwphyhj67apssexjr9du4qc2md5whd6p
transaction
ec3cbae289bc02ff7e1fd16b9c6abbbaef403855ea250181a83acb183f71a5cf
confirmations
193759
spent
true